Title: Innovations of Ying Li in Astronomical Optics
Introduction
Ying Li is a prominent inventor based in Jiangsu, China, known for his contributions to the field of astronomical optics. With a total of 2 patents, he has developed innovative methods that enhance the accuracy and efficiency of optical systems.
Latest Patents
Ying Li's latest patents include a "Method for correcting pointing errors of biaxial rotation system based on spherical cap function." This invention provides a systematic approach to correcting pointing errors by utilizing a spherical cap function model, which ensures high correction accuracy and stability against measurement noise. His second patent, "Method for rendering on basis of hemispherical orthogonal function," outlines a technique for rendering that incorporates a hemispherical orthogonal function to improve the representation of materials in optical systems.
Career Highlights
Ying Li is affiliated with the Nanjing Institute of Astronomical Optics & Technology, which is part of the National Astronomical Observatories. His work focuses on advancing the technology used in astronomical observations and enhancing the performance of optical instruments.
